I am running Windows 8 Professional 64-bit and encounter the following error when booting:
System:
Windows 8 Professional x86_64
Intel Core i7 3770K (Ivy Bridge)
4 x 4 GB Corsair Vengeance
4 random SATA2 HDDs and a Corsair Force Series 2 SSD
ASRock Z77 Pro3 (Mainboard)

Before the error ocurred
I was attempting to launch The Elder Scrolls: Skyrim which failed to start properly and I had to force a reboot on my computer
Windows was stuck for 10 minutes and i forced another reboot to find the automatic repair screen. The automatic repair failed and when I rebooted I had this new problem.

Error
Your PC needs to be repaired

The application or operating system couldn't be loaded because a required file is missing or contains errors.
File: Windowssystem32winload.efi
Error code: 0xc0000225
You'll need to use the recovery tools on your installation media. If you don't have any installation media (like a disc or USB device), contact your system administrator or PC manufacturer

Press Enter to try again
Press F8 for Startup Settings

Attempted fixes

1 - Press F8
Screen flashes quickly but nothing else happens
2 - Reboot computer with installation media (USB 3 stick)
Computer failed to get past POST check
Moved USB stick to another port and booted from it and followed this procedure:
Automatic System Repair - Didn't work
System Restore - Didn't work
BootRec /RebuildBCD, BootRec /FixBoot, BootRec /FixMBR - No difference here either
Refresh PC from repair DVD - &quotAn error ocurred while refreshing your PC, no changes were made&quot
3 - Check for faulty hardware
Running chkdsk on system drive
Tried booting using nothing but the system drive attached
Tested all RAM sticks
Checked with another graphics card
Tried CMOS reset
Flashed newer BIOS
Tried alternative installation media (DVD)
4 - Google the issue
Only to find the same solutions as the ones I already tried on instinct.

I am completely lost... What else could possibly be wrong? How can I fix it?
